Serviced Offices Lewisham

Office Space Lewisham

Our easy to use, free search service is focused on finding you premium business premises in Lewisham at competitive rental prices. Our knowledgeable advisors are waiting to help you locate and secure the ideal business accommodation, from business centre space, collaborative and project spaces and shared office accommodation to individual workstations, meeting rooms, unfurnished space, industrial units and virtual office solutions. We have an extensive portfolio of South London commercial property and if we don't currently have what you need, we'll go out and find it!

Try our search service for free now - we promise to help you find the perfect business premises in South London at a cost effective price.

Call us now +44 020 3965 9617

71 Lewisham High Street

SE13 5JX Private & Serviced Offices

This centre is a great space that has been designed to meet the demands of any modern business. This new business centre offers private offices and co-working space in the heart of London. The centre is accessible 24 hours a day so the clients can work flexibly. Occupants can benefit from equipped meeting rooms and cosy break-out spaces. The auditorium is a great place to...

Read More
  • Private Offices
  • Inclusive of Services
  • Fixed Cost
  • Fast Move In
  • Furnished Workspace
  • Shared Internet Access
  • Building Access 24/7
  • Day/Night Security
  • Wi-Fi
Call us now +44 020 3965 9617

Romer House, 132 Lewisham High Street

SE13 6EE Private & Serviced Offices 1 To 17 People From 219 per month

Open plan office space at this welcoming business hub in Lewisham town centre offers a modern and attractive base to work and meet. From coworking areas to creative breakout spaces, the property incorporates unique design elements to encourage a collaborative and productive environment.

Bright and spacious offices are tastefully decorated and beautifully...

Read More
  • Furnished Workspace
  • Shared Internet Access
  • Building Access 24/7
  • Day/Night Security
  • IT Support Available
  • Kitchen Facilities
  • Central Heating System
  • Cleaning Services
  • Male & Female WC
Call us now +44 020 3965 9617

44-50 Royal Parade Mews, Blackheath

SE3 0TN Private & Serviced Offices 3 To 8 People From 450 per month

Housing a former Victorian fire station stable, this centre has been transformed into a stunning two-floor office building. Set in the heart of Blackheath Village, it's only 5 minutes from Blackheath Station, which will whisk you to Zone 1 in just 12 minutes. Offering a new, compelling and flexible way to work, joining The Workers' League gives you all the benefits of a...

Read More
  • Shared Workspace
  • Private Offices
  • Inclusive of Services
  • Fixed Cost
  • Fast Move In
  • Furnished Workspace
  • Shared Internet Access
  • Wi-Fi
  • Cleaning Services
Call us now +44 020 3965 9617

Why You Should Rent Lewisham Offices

The area of Lewisham, in the Royal London Borough of Lewisham and the historic county of Kent, is bordered by New Cross and Deptford to the north, Eltham to the east, Beckenham and Bromley to the south and Peckham to the west. Lewisham is south east of the United Kingdom capital, just 8 miles from Central London and the West End and 7 miles south of the important business location of Canary Wharf.

The serviced office options, private offices and coworking spaces in Lewisham are housed in a variety of property types, and have all the premium services and amenities to ensure your business needs are fully provided for.

Most of the office space to rent in Lewisham comes with meeting rooms, air conditioning, fast broadband and Wi Fi, kitchen facilities, bike racks, 24 hour secure access and onsite car parks as standard inclusions for tenants. Private offices and shared workspaces in Lewisham often come with additional features, too, such as manned reception and administrative services, IT support, mail handling, conference rooms, lounge areas, and onsite management, all on flexible lease terms.

When choosing office space to rent in Lewisham, you can rest assured all your business needs will be supported, so you can just concentrate on growth and success.

Transport Links

Your Lewisham serviced offices will be conveniently close to a number of major transport links that service this emerging business hub south east of central London. Lewisham (LEW) station is conveniently in the centre of the borough, and is located near many office buildings and the expansive Lewisham Shopping Centre. LEW provides train services on the Thameslink and southeastern lines, connecting up to Greenwich, Deptford and across to New Cross Gate station, and onwards to Surrey Quays, South Bermondsey station and central London. Blackheath, Ladywell and Hither Green stations also provide southeastern and Thameslink rail services in Lewisham.

Docklands Light Railway (DLR) services also depart from Lewisham’s central station, connecting commuters to the Thameside locations of Greenwich and Deptford. Lewisham is additionally serviced by an expansive network of bus routes, providing links to Forest Hill, Surrey Quays, Greenwich and more. When choosing Lewisham to locate your new serviced offices or coworking space, your commuting needs and travel to central London and the wider United Kingdom will easily be provided for.

Serviced Office Solutions

Serviced Offices

SMEs are the most common serviced office occupier. First-time business owners are also typical tenants, as a serviced office is perceived as a less risky option when compared to conventional office space.

All-inclusive pricing. Short / flexible lease length. Less capital expenditure. Opportunities for networking. No dilapidation costs.

Business space solutions

Business Centre/Park Space

Business centre and business park space is available in a number of forms including serviced offices, virtual offices, hot desks, and shared office space.

Flexibility. Better value than conventional space. Creative allocation of space and high quality premises. Lower financial risks. No legal or commercial agent costs.

Warehouse & Industrial Unit Office Solutions

Industrial Units & Warehousing

There is approximately 47 million square feet of industrial space in London, much of which is occupied by a diverse range of businesses across various industry sectors.

Convenient access to local and international markets. This sub-market continues to outperform other commercial property sectors . Low rent volatility. Economical and highly efficient.

Need help?

Our London Office Space experts will be happy to help with any questions. New office locations and options become available every day, so please get in touch if you need more detailed information about any of these offices or other local alternatives.

Call +44 020 3965 9617